Prithvi Narayan Shah, considered the founder of the modern state of Nepal, orginaly from the village of Gorkha, he conquered an area that today encompasses not only Nepal, but parts of India, and Tibet too. He moved the capital to Khatmandu, and opened relations with the British.



The UU for Nepal should be the Gurkha, which too this day are some of the best trained solidars on the planet. The British loved them in their East Asia territories, but before they were used by the royalty. I don't know how many Unique Units you want, but this works for late industrial to modern age. Could replace rifleman, or infantry.
